Output 58ba157291c68f70be4a182619525a56e28694f866598f08aa63dfc9a94ce311:6

value
92566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79c36bf0311584efce774e340ce5ac31733629cd OP_EQUALVERIFY OP_CHECKSIG
address
1C6psLzMnEFNJzQmD2A7xCXtiV7wAaqWfr
transaction
58ba157291c68f70be4a182619525a56e28694f866598f08aa63dfc9a94ce311
spent
true